1. Fitted White Shirt – Best classic outfit pairing for black bootcut jeans minimal smart style
A fitted white shirt creates a sharp visual contrast against black bootcut jeans, producing a clean and structured outfit. The brightness on top naturally draws attention upward while the darker denim grounds the overall look.
Tucking the shirt into the waistband defines the waistline and improves proportion instantly. A slight sleeve roll softens the formal tone and makes the outfit more adaptable for everyday wear.
This pairing works well because it transitions easily between casual and semi-formal environments. It delivers a polished appearance without requiring complex styling decisions.

2. Black Turtleneck – Best monochrome outfit idea for black bootcut jeans sleek winter style
A black turtleneck paired with black bootcut jeans creates a seamless monochrome silhouette. The uninterrupted color line visually elongates the body and enhances a sleek appearance.
Fit becomes the most important factor in this combination since color variation is minimal. A well-fitted turtleneck ensures the outfit looks intentional rather than flat.
This pairing works especially well in colder months when layering is reduced. It delivers a refined, understated aesthetic that feels modern and controlled.

3. Oversized Blazer – Best street style outfit combination for black bootcut jeans trendy layered look
An oversized blazer adds structured volume on top while black bootcut jeans balance the lower half. This contrast creates a strong fashion-forward silhouette that feels current and expressive.
A fitted inner top underneath helps maintain proportion and prevents the outfit from appearing oversized overall. Neutral blazer tones often enhance versatility and styling flexibility.
This combination is frequently seen in modern street fashion because it blends relaxed and tailored elements. It delivers a confident look without appearing overly styled.

5. Cropped Jacket – Best balanced layered outfit for black bootcut jeans waist defining street style
A cropped jacket highlights the waistline, making it a strong match for black bootcut jeans. It balances the flared hem while improving overall silhouette structure.
Depending on material, it can shift toward edgy leather styling or soft denim layering. A fitted inner top keeps proportions controlled and visually clean.
This pairing works well when a structured yet relaxed outfit is desired. It adds depth without making the styling feel complicated.

6. Chunky Sweater – Best cozy winter outfit for black bootcut jeans relaxed cold weather style
A chunky sweater brings warmth and softness when paired with black bootcut jeans. The volume on top contrasts nicely with the structured flare at the bottom.
A partial front tuck helps define the waist and prevents the outfit from appearing oversized. Neutral tones keep the look calm and visually balanced.
This combination works best in colder seasons when comfort becomes a priority. It delivers a relaxed yet stylish winter outfit.
